In the Functional Analysis category, you will find textbooks, introductory works, and advanced texts on complex analysis. The titles cover fundamentals such as the Riemann number sphere, Möbius transformations, elliptic functions, and Cauchy’s formula, as well as applications in quantum mechanics, optimal control, and integral transforms. Additionally, topics such as complex manifolds, Riemann surfaces, Julia and Mandelbrot sets, and generalizations to quaternions and Clifford algebras are covered.
The works are intended for students, instructors, and professionals in mathematics, physics, and engineering. In addition to classic textbooks and review guides, the collection also includes workbooks with exercises and solutions, current research articles, and introductions to special functions and differential equations with complex variables.
